dart.pkg.collection.equality library

*<Null safety>*

Classes

CaseInsensitiveEquality

String equality that's insensitive to differences in ASCII case. ...

DeepCollectionEquality

Deep equality on collections. ...

DefaultEquality<E>

Equality of objects that compares only the natural equality of the objects. ...

Equality<E>

A generic equality relation on objects.

EqualityBy<E, F>

Equality of objects based on derived values. ...

IdentityEquality<E>

Equality of objects that compares only the identity of the objects.

IterableEquality<E>

Equality on iterables. ...

ListEquality<E>

Equality on lists. ...

MapEquality<K, V>

Equality on maps. ...

MultiEquality<E>

Combines several equalities into a single equality. ...

SetEquality<E>

Equality of sets. ...

UnorderedIterableEquality<E>

Equality of the elements of two iterables without considering order. ...